Materials Needed

  • Yarn: Worsted weight yarn in brown, cream, and orange
  • Hook: 3.5 mm crochet hook
  • Stuffing: Fiberfill or any stuffing material
  • Scissors: For cutting yarn
  • Tapestry needle: For sewing pieces together

Step-by-Step Instructions

Body

  1. Start with a magic ring using the brown yarn.
  2. Round 1: Work 6 single crochets (sc) into the magic ring. (Total: 6 stitches)
  3. Round 2: Increase in each stitch around. (Total: 12 stitches)
  4. Round 3: *Single crochet in the next stitch, then increase* around. (Total: 18 stitches)
  5. Round 4: *Single crochet in the next 2 stitches, then increase* around. (Total: 24 stitches)
  6. Continue this increasing pattern until you reach a total of 42 stitches.
  7. Work evenly for 10 rounds without increasing or decreasing.
  8. Begin decreasing: *Single crochet in the next 5 stitches, then decrease* around. (Total: 36 stitches)
  9. Continue decreasing until you have 6 stitches left. Fasten off and stuff the body firmly with fiberfill.

Wings (Make 2)

  1. With brown yarn, chain (ch) 6.
  2. Row 1: Single crochet in the 2nd chain from the hook and across. (Total: 5 stitches)
  3. Row 2: Chain 1, turn, decrease, single crochet in the next stitch, decrease. (Total: 3 stitches)
  4. Row 3: Chain 1, turn, decrease, single crochet. (Total: 2 stitches)
  5. Row 4: Chain 1, turn, decrease. Fasten off.

Eyes (Make 2)

  1. With cream yarn, make a magic ring.
  2. Round 1: Work 6 single crochets into the ring. (Total: 6 stitches)
  3. Round 2: Increase in each stitch around. (Total: 12 stitches)
  4. Fasten off, leaving a long tail for sewing.

Beak

  1. With orange yarn, chain 3.
  2. Row 1: Single crochet in the 2nd chain from the hook and in the next stitch. (Total: 2 stitches)
  3. Row 2: Chain 1, turn, decrease. Fasten off.

Assembly

  1. Sew the wings to the sides of the body, positioning them slightly below the top.
  2. Attach the eyes to the front of the body, slightly above the center for a cute expression.
  3. Sew the beak between the eyes, ensuring it is centered.
  4. Embroider small details with black yarn for pupils and any additional features you desire.
